And I added a short tip about read-only mode. --- CAR INSTALL.md | 18 ++++++++++++++++++ 1 file changed, 18 insertions(+) diff --git a/CAR INSTALL.md b/CAR INSTALL.md index 062b6df5..b24c86c7 100644 --- a/CAR INSTALL.md +++ b/CAR INSTALL.md @@ -193,6 +193,24 @@ denyinterfaces wlan0 ``` From this point on, at least on the Raspberry Pi, if you reboot the machine, it will not reconnect to your network – instead, it will act as the WiFi base station you have configured with `hostapd` and `isc-dhcp-server`. +### Optimise startup time + +There are quite a few services that are not necessary for this setup. Disabling them can increase startup time. Running these commands disables them: + +```` +sudo systemctl disable systemd-timesyncd.service +sudo systemctl disable keyboard-setup.service +sudo systemctl disable triggerhappy.service +sudo systemctl disable dhcpcd.service +sudo systemctl disable wpa_supplicant.service +sudo systemctl disable dphys-swapfile.service +sudo systemctl disable networking.service +```` + +### Read-only mode + +Run `sudo raspi-config` and then choose `Performance Options` > `Overlay Filesystem` and choose to enable the overlay filesystem, and to set the boot partition to be write-protected. + ### Ready Install the Raspberry Pi in your car.
